The Most Dangerous Man in America
📅 Friday, 16 October 2009⏱️ 1h 32m
🎬 Directed by Judith Ehrlich🏢 Kovno Communications
★ 7.4
★★★★★
TMDB Rating
"The Most Dangerous Man in America" is the story of what happens when a former Pentagon insider, armed only with his conscience, steadfast determination, and a file cabinet full of classified documents, decides to challenge an "imperial" presidency – answerable to neither Congress, the press, nor the people – in order to help end the Vietnam War.
